I started this program two months after I graduated CSUCI and have been working non-stop since! This program is accelerated so there is a great deal of work, classes, and of course, student teaching. I am currently student teaching at Hiram Johnson High School in Sacramento, California. I teach an Intermediate ELD course and a sophomore English course.

Many of my students come from poverty and struggle with gang issues, drugs, and family problems on a day-to-day basis. Working with at-risk students has been an amazing learning experience for me. I have gained new perspectives and learned to adapt my teaching to cater to a diverse range of student needs. The program has been phenomenal and I have really grown in my abilities to manage a classroom and challenge students with engaging, educational lessons.

I just signed a contract with the Woodland Joint Unified School District to teach at Douglass Middle School in Woodland, California for next year, which I am really excited about! I am graduating on June 11, 2008 with my single-subject credentials and will (hopefully) receive my master's degree in March 2009.
